Allen University Stats
Enrollment Deposit
How much is Allen's enrollment deposit?
Allen University requires a deposit of $531 to confirm your enrollment.
National Rank
96.00%
Allen University is in the top 96.00% of colleges in the country for deposit cost. Nationally, 23.16% of colleges do not require a deposit.
State Rank
100.00%
Allen University is in the top 100.00% of colleges in the state of South Carolina for deposit cost. 12.50% of colleges in the state do not require a deposit.
Type Rank
94.90%
Allen University is in the top 94.90% of Private not-for-profit, 4-year or above colleges for deposit cost. 14.62% of private colleges do not require a deposit.

Student Population
Allen University educates a diverse community of 796 students, with 707 pursuing undergraduate degrees and 89 engaged in advanced graduate studies.
Total Enrollment
796
Total Undergraduates
707
Total Graduates
89
95% Full-Time
5% Part-Time

Admissions
The admission process at Allen University has a 32% acceptance rate. Allen University has test required that focus on each student's unique potential.
Acceptance Rate
32%
Application Fee
$0
SAT
Students submitting SAT
1%
ACT
Students submitting ACT
1%

Location
Located in Columbia, SC, Allen University offers students a dynamic urban experience with all the advantages of a midsize city environment.
City
Columbia
County
Richland County
State
South Carolina
Country
United States
Urbanization
City: Midsize

About
Allen University features a student-focused approach with a 16 : 1 student-faculty ratio, African Methodist Episcopal values, and competitive NCAA athletic programs that enhance the college experience.
Student-to-Faculty Ratio
16 : 1
Religious Affiliation
African Methodist Episcopal
Division in Athletics
NCAA
Sector
Private not-for-profit, 4-year or above

Cost
Allen University makes education accessible, offering an average net price of $13,774 with 98% of students receiving financial assistance including 80% benefiting from Pell Grants.
Average Net Price
$13,774
Received Aid
98%
Pell Recipients
80%
$6,270 In-State
$6,270 Out-of-State

Outcomes
Allen University prioritizes student success, demonstrated by a 23% graduation rate and the achievements of alumni who make meaningful contributions in their communities and careers.
Graduation Rate
23%
